DocuSign Java Client LICENSE
This is an agreement between You ("You") and DocuSign Corporation, located at 1301 Second Avenue, Suite 2000, Seattle, WA 98101, ("DocuSign") regarding Your use of the DocuSign Java Client and any associated documentation, software code or other materials made available by DocuSign (collectively referred to in this agreement as the "DocuSign Java Client"). The DocuSign Java Client includes documentation for one or more DocuSign application programming interfaces (collectively the "APIs"), which may be further defined in API-specific Terms of Use ("TOU"), and any software code provided by DocuSign in conjunction with such documentation. The DocuSign Java Client is made available by DocuSign to assist developers in integrating certain functionality of the DocuSign services made available through the APIs (the "Services") into applications. This agreement applies to any updates, supplements or support services for the DocuSign Java Client, unless other terms accompany those items. If so, those other terms apply.
By installing, accessing or otherwise using the DocuSign Java Client, You accept the terms of this agreement. If You do not agree to the terms of this agreement, do not install, access or use the DocuSign Java Client or the APIs.
If You comply with this agreement, You have the rights below.
(1) USE OF THE DocuSign Java Client. Subject to Your compliance with this agreement, DocuSign hereby authorizes You to use the DocuSign Java Client solely for the purpose of creating applications designed to operate with the Services (referred to as "Authorized Applications"). You may not rent, lease or lend any of Your rights in the DocuSign Java Client or access to the Services. You may make a reasonable number of copies of the DocuSign Java Client for the purposes set forth herein, provided that You reproduce only complete copies, including without limitation all "read me" files, copyright notices, and other legal notices and terms that DocuSign has included in the DocuSign Java Client, and provided that You may not distribute any copy, partial or complete, You make of the DocuSign Java Client. Your Authorized Applications: will include functionality that enables end users to access and use all features available through the Services; will not include any independent features or functionality that are substantially similar to or compete with the functionality available through the Services; and will not provide access to or promote any services that are substantially similar to or compete with the Services.
(2) SCOPE OF LICENSE. The DocuSign Java Client is licensed, not sold. This agreement only gives You some rights to use the DocuSign Java Client. DocuSign reserves all other rights. DocuSign specifically does not grant any express or implied rights under its patents with respect to your Authorized Applications. Unless applicable law gives You more rights despite this limitation, You may use the DocuSign Java Client only as expressly permitted in this agreement. In doing so, You must comply with any technical limitations in the DocuSign Java Client that only allow You to use it in certain ways. You may not: (a) reverse engineer, decompile, distribute or disassemble the DocuSign Java Client, except and only to the extent that applicable law expressly permits, despite this limitation; or (b) make more copies of the DocuSign Java Client than specified in this agreement, except and only to the extent applicable law expressly permits, despite this limitation; or (c) publish the DocuSign Java Client for others to copy; or (d) rent, lease or lend the DocuSign Java Client.
(3) USE OF THE SERVICES. Your use of the Services, and the use of the Services by anyone hosting or using your Authorized Application, is governed by the then-current TOU which can be found on: https://www.docusign.net.
(4) EXPORT RESTRICTIONS. THE DocuSign Java Client IS SUBJECT TO UNITED STATES EXPORT LAWS AND REGULATIONS. YOU MUST COMPLY WITH ALL DOMESTIC AND INTERNATIONAL EXPORT LAWS AND REGULATIONS THAT APPLY TO THE DocuSign Java Client. THESE LAWS INCLUDE RESTRICTIONS ON DESTINATIONS, END USERS AND END USE.
(5) SUPPORT. DocuSign is not obligated to provide any technical or other support ("Support Services") for the DocuSign Java Client or Services to You. However, if DocuSign chooses to provide any Support Services to You, Your use of such Support Services will be governed by then-current DocuSign policies. With respect to any technical or other information You provide to DocuSign in connection with the Support Services, You agree that DocuSign has an unrestricted right to use such information for its business purposes, including for product support and development. DocuSign will not use such information in a form that personally identifies You.
(6) LICENSED MARKS. DocuSign hereby grants You a limited, revocable, nonexclusive and nontransferable right to use DocuSign's regular trade names, trademarks, titles and logos ("Licensed Marks") solely for purposes of identifying DocuSign's products and services. Details of this trademark license are available at: http://www.docusign.com/IP.
(7) FEES. DocuSign may choose in the future to charge for use of the DocuSign Java Client, the APIs and/or Services. If DocuSign in its sole discretion chooses to establish fees and payment terms for such use, DocuSign will provide notice of such terms as provided in Section 10 below, and You may elect to stop using the DocuSign Java Client, APIs and/or Services rather than incurring fees.
(8) TERMINATION. DocuSign reserves the right to discontinue offering the DocuSign Java Client, APIs and Services or to modify the DocuSign Java Client, APIs or Services at any time in its sole discretion. If You are dissatisfied with any aspect of the DocuSign Java Client, APIs or Services at any time, Your sole and exclusive remedy is to cease using them. Notwithstanding anything contained in the agreement to the contrary, DocuSign may also, in its sole discretion, terminate or suspend access to the APIs and Services to You or any end user at any time. You acknowledge that termination and/or monetary damages may not be a sufficient remedy if You breach this agreement and that DocuSign will be entitled, without waiving any other rights or remedies, to injunctive or equitable relief as may be deemed proper by a court of competent jurisdiction in the event of a breach. This Section and Sections 3, 4, 6, 7, 8, 9, 11, 12, 13, 14, 15 and 16 will survive termination of this agreement or any discontinuation of the offering of the DocuSign Java Client, APIs or Services, along with any other provisions that would reasonably be deemed to survive such events.
(9) RESERVATION OF RIGHTS. Except for the licenses expressly granted under this agreement, DocuSign and its suppliers retain all right, title and interest in and to the DocuSign Java Client, APIs, Services, and all intellectual property rights therein. You are not authorized to alter, modify, copy, edit, format, create derivative works of or otherwise use any materials, content or technology provided under this agreement except as explicitly provided in this agreement or approved in advance in writing by DocuSign.
(10) MODIFICATIONS; NOTICES. If we change this contract, then we will give you notice before the change is in force. If you do not agree to these changes, then you must cancel and stop using the DocuSign Java Client, Services and APIs before the changes are in force. If you do not stop using the DocuSign Java Client, Services or APIs, then your use of the DocuSign Java Client, Services or APIs will continue under the changed contract. DocuSign may give notices to You, at DocuSign's option, by posting on any portion of https://docusign.net or by electronic mail to any e-mail address provided by You to DocuSign.
(11) ENTIRE AGREEMENT. This agreement, and any applicable TOU or contract for Services, are the entire agreement with respect to the DocuSign Java Client, the Services and the APIs.
(12) APPLICABLE LAW AND VENUE
Washington state law governs the interpretation of this agreement and applies to claims for breach of it, regardless of conflict of laws principles. The laws of the state where You live govern all other claims, including claims under state consumer protection laws, unfair competition laws, and in tort. You agree that any action brought under this agreement will be subject to exclusive jurisdiction and venue in the state and federal courts located in Seattle, Washington.
(13) LEGAL EFFECT. This agreement describes certain legal rights. You may have other rights under the laws of Your country. This agreement does not change Your rights under the laws of Your country if the laws of Your country do not permit it to do so.
(14) DISCLAIMER OF WARRANTY. The DocuSign Java Client is licensed "as-is." You bear the risk of using it. DocuSign gives no express or implied warranties, guarantees or conditions. You may have additional consumer rights under Your local laws which this agreement cannot change. To the extent permitted under Your local laws, DocuSign excludes the implied warranties of merchantability, fitness for a particular purpose and non-infringement. DocuSign does not represent or warrant that the DocuSign Java Client or the Services will always be available, uninterrupted, secure, or error free.
(15) LIMITATION ON AND EXCLUSION OF REMEDIES AND DAMAGES. You can recover from DocuSign and its suppliers only direct damages up to U.S. $5.00. You cannot recover any other damages, including consequential, lost profits, special, indirect or incidental damages. This limitation applies to:
(a) anything related to the DocuSign Java Client, services, content (including code) on third party Internet sites, or third party programs; and
(b) claims for breach of contract, breach of warranty, guarantee or condition, strict liability, negligence, or other tort to the extent permitted by applicable law.
It applies even if DocuSign knew or should have known about the possibility of the damages. The above limitation or exclusion may not apply to You because Your country may not allow the exclusion or limitation of incidental, consequential or other damages.
